The geographical location of your personal home plays a big role in figuring out the appropriate roofing type. Homes in areas with heavy snowfall should have a steeply pitched roof to permit snow to slide off easily. This helps stop ice dams and protects the house from potential water harm. On the other hand, areas that experience excessive heat profit from a flatter roof the place ventilation may help keep the home cool.


Material selection is one other crucial factor to contemplate when exploring roofing types. Different roofing materials provide various advantages. Asphalt shingles stay a popular selection due to their affordability and big selection of designs. Metal roofs, recognized for his or her longevity and resistance to excessive climate, are additionally worth contemplating. Wood shakes and tiles current unique aesthetic qualities but require more maintenance.

 

 

 

 
Aesthetics should not be overlooked during your analysis process. The style of your home—be it conventional, modern, or rustic—will greatly influence which roofing options are suitable. For instance, a Victorian-style house may profit from a more ornate, steep roof with intricate detailing, whereas a sleek, modern construction may do higher with a low-slope or flat roof design.

Energy efficiency is particularly related in today's eco-conscious market. Selecting a roofing fashion that includes energy-efficient materials can help scale back utility payments. Light-colored roofs reflect daylight, serving to to maintain your house cooler in the course of the summer time months. Utilizing energy-efficient insulation in conjunction with the right roofing style further enhances this benefit, creating a comfortable living environment year-round.




Weather situations also needs to influence your roofing type selection. Areas prone to hurricanes or heavy rains often require reinforced materials and tighter seals. For houses situated in hotter climates, roofs designed to cut back warmth absorption can significantly contribute to power conservation. Knowing the precise weather patterns in your space allows for higher decision-making in terms of sturdiness and maintenance needs.


Budget concerns are inevitable when choosing a roofing type. Different kinds include various worth tags and long-term maintenance prices. While cheaper materials could save you cash upfront, opting for higher-quality choices might present higher long-term value and longevity, reducing the need for frequent repairs or replacements.

The lifespan of roofing materials is another essential side to ponder. While asphalt shingles typically last round 15 to 30 years, metal roofs can simply exceed 50 years. Investing in a more durable roofing style might alleviate the monetary strain of getting to switch your roof as regularly. Such foresight may enhance both the home’s value and your peace of mind.
